Output ab8cbba90b160bfa5afb81824fb77d10ad1815b356d10f1615385027d008e85e:5

value
21795646
script pubkey
OP_0 OP_PUSHBYTES_20 678b1e326385e3a4fb3023c04ca0756e4107571e
address
bc1qv793uvnrsh36f7esy0qyegr4deqsw4c7gk7y60
transaction
ab8cbba90b160bfa5afb81824fb77d10ad1815b356d10f1615385027d008e85e
spent
true